The Data Center Technician II will assist with installation of hardware into racks, asset tagging and scanning, cabling, data center maintenance, documenting processes and server installations.

Scope

  • Works on assignments that are moderately difficult, requiring judgment in resolving issues
  • Requires some instruction on new assignments and infrequent checks on daily work

Your Roles and Responsibilities

  • Participate in installing, moving, and decommissioning hardware including cabinets, shelves, power strips, rails, fiber / copper / other cables and cable management, servers, storage, and other devices in the Data Center.
  • Confirm and label devices, rack and cables.
  • Work in a standard ticketing system, providing clear, timely, and appropriate customer communications.
  • Work under the direction of Site Operations Supervisor and / or Operations Manager) and follow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), Program Policies, Safety Policies, and Security Policies, while meeting requirements for quality and quantity of work.
  • Other duties as required. This list is not meant to be a comprehensive inventory of all responsibilities assigned to this position
  • Required Qualifications / Skills

  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ED) and 2 to 5 years' related experience and / or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English
  • Ability to respond to any On-Call request within 1 hour, while on-call
  • Effectively utilize the ticket management systems
  • Ability to cable systems (power / copper / fiber / other) correctly based on ticket requirements and SOP standards
  • Experience working with CAT5e and CAT6 copper cable and multi-mode and single-mode fiber
  • Ability to adapt to changing priorities, conditions, and circumstances
  • Working knowledge of computer hardware
  • Understanding of networking components and infrastructures
  • Knowledge of copper and fiber testers
  • Understanding of Data Center best practices (i.e. basic fault tolerance, cable routing, calculating power usage)
  • Experience with cable management and knowledge of how to run fiber and copper in a data center
  • Some knowledge of Data-Center electrical, HVAC, and bandwidth infrastructures as well as fiber / copper topologies
  • Able to operate material handling equipment – server lifts, pallet jacks, and forklifts (if certified)
  • Ability to learn new software
  • Must provide own transportation to work locations
  • Preferred Qualifications

  • Certifications in Data Center technologies are desired
  • Hands on experience in electrical, HVAC, and data center infrastructures
  • Working knowledge of networking components and infrastructures, including Wi-Fi
  • Physical Demand & Work Environment

  • Physically assist in moving and racking equipment.
  • Able to safely lift and move a minimum of fifty (50) pounds
  • Must have the ability to perform office-related tasks which may include prolonged sitting or standing
  • Must have the ability to move from place to place within an office environment
  • Must be able to use a computer
  • Must have the ability to communicate effectively
  • Some positions may require occasional repetitive motion or movements of the wrists, hands, and / or fingers
